当前使用的设置如下:Backbone、Parse、Require和Marionette。
我通过我的应用程序发现,我经常需要重用已经从 Parse 中提取的对象。
Parse 已经做到了这一点Parse.User.current()
,但是最好在本地存储其他实体而不是一遍又一遍地检索它们。
是否有人对用于在本地缓存这些对象的良好实践或库有任何建议,或者在应用程序运行时拥有保存信息的全局变量就足够了?
当前使用的设置如下:Backbone、Parse、Require和Marionette。
我通过我的应用程序发现,我经常需要重用已经从 Parse 中提取的对象。
Parse 已经做到了这一点Parse.User.current()
,但是最好在本地存储其他实体而不是一遍又一遍地检索它们。
是否有人对用于在本地缓存这些对象的良好实践或库有任何建议,或者在应用程序运行时拥有保存信息的全局变量就足够了?
Parse JavaScript SDK 是开源的,因此您可以查看 和 的Parse.User.current
实现Parse.User._saveCurrentUser
。也许你可以做类似的事情。 http://www.parsecdn.com/js/parse-1.1.11.js